  1. Check Your Account Status: Before attempting to bypass a Steam ban, it is important to check your account status and make sure that you are actually banned. This can be done by logging into your Steam account and checking the “Account Status” section of the settings page.

  2. Contact Steam Support: If you have been banned from Steam, it is important to contact the support team as soon as possible in order to explain your situation and request an appeal of the ban.

  3. Create a New Account: If you are unable to get your ban overturned, then creating a new account may be necessary in order to continue using Steam services. It is important to note that creating multiple accounts may result in further bans or restrictions on all accounts associated with the same IP address or payment method.
